The Follicle’s Ancient Blueprint
The journey into textured hair’s fundamental differences begins beneath the skin, with the hair follicle itself. In straight hair, the follicle typically presents as a circular opening, guiding the hair shaft upwards in a relatively even, cylindrical form. However, for those with textured hair, the follicle adopts a distinctly oval or elliptical shape. This particular architecture acts as a natural sculptor, dictating the hair’s very trajectory as it emerges from the scalp.
The elliptical opening compels the hair shaft to grow not in a perfectly straight line, but to curve and coil, initiating the very curl that defines its appearance. Shaft’s Embrace of Form
Following the follicle’s lead, the hair shaft itself takes on a varied morphology. Where straight hair presents a round, uniform cross-section, textured hair often exhibits a flattened or ribbon-like cross-sectional shape. Consider the subtle shift in a river’s course when it encounters varied terrain; the water flows and bends, adapting to the landscape. Similarly, as textured hair grows, its non-uniform shape, combined with the elliptical follicle, causes it to twist and turn upon itself.
This torsional stress along the shaft generates points of natural bending, culminating in the intricate coils, waves, and zig-zags we so admire. Cortical Cells and the Helix
Venturing deeper into the strand, the cortical cells—the primary building blocks of the hair shaft—reveal another layer of difference. In textured hair, these cells are often distributed unevenly within the shaft, particularly in the inner and outer curves of the hair. This uneven distribution contributes to the hair’s natural inclination to coil. Imagine a sturdy vine, its growth propelled by forces that might be slightly stronger on one side than the other, causing it to spiral upwards.
Similarly, this internal asymmetry in cortical cell arrangement contributes to the helical nature of the textured hair strand, a biological marvel that echoes the spirals of ancient designs found in West African art and architecture. This internal structure, inherently different, contributes to the resilience and unique behavior of each curl.
An insightful study by Feughelman (1997) highlighted that the mechanical properties of human hair fibers, particularly their ability to coil, are deeply tied to the differential organization and growth patterns of the cortical cells, specifically the orthocortex and paracortex. In textured hair, the uneven distribution of these two distinct cortical cell types, often arranged eccentrically, leads to differential contraction and expansion, resulting in the hair’s inherent curl. Cuticle’s Protective Scale
The outermost layer of the hair, the cuticle, acts as a protective shield, composed of overlapping scales. In straight hair, these scales lie relatively flat, creating a smooth surface that efficiently reflects light and allows natural oils to travel down the shaft with ease. For textured hair, however, the very curves and coils mean that the cuticle scales do not always lie as uniformly flat. At the points where the hair bends and turns, the cuticle can be more lifted or irregular.
This characteristic can impact how the hair retains moisture, making it more prone to dehydration, and also affecting its shine. The historical knowledge of this inherent quality, passed down through generations, shaped traditional practices involving rich oils and butters, aimed at sealing these scales and preserving moisture, a silent acknowledgment of the hair’s structural needs long before scientific articulation.

Protective Styling’s Ancient Roots?
Consider the practice of Protective Styling, a cornerstone of textured hair care today. The very coiling nature of textured hair, with its increased potential for tangling and breakage due to less uniform cuticle alignment and numerous points of torsion, naturally led to the development of styles that minimized manipulation. Braids, twists, and locs were not simply aesthetic choices; they were strategic expressions of wisdom, designed to guard the hair against environmental elements and daily wear. In ancient African societies, these styles carried immense social, spiritual, and cultural weight.
They signaled marital status, age, tribal affiliation, and even spiritual devotion. The cornrow, for instance, a technique that involves braiding hair very close to the scalp in continuous, raised rows, can be traced back to various ancient African civilizations. Its intricate patterns, which inherently protect the hair shaft from environmental exposure and daily friction, were a direct response to the structural needs of coiled and curly strands. For instance, the use of certain indigenous plants, like Shea Butter (Vitellaria paradoxa) or Marula Oil (Sclerocarya birrea), became widespread because their occlusive properties effectively sealed moisture into the naturally more porous and drier strands of textured hair.
This practice, often performed during elaborate grooming rituals, directly countered the challenges posed by the lifted cuticle scales, a characteristic intrinsic to the hair’s structural bends. These traditional ingredients and methods, honed over generations, are powerful echoes of an ancestral science, validating their efficacy through lived experience.
- Shea Butter ❉ A rich emollient traditionally used across West Africa to moisturize and protect textured hair, counteracting its propensity for dryness stemming from lifted cuticles.
- Coconut Oil ❉ Widespread in tropical regions, historically applied to strengthen hair strands and impart shine, acknowledging the hair’s need for consistent lubrication due to its structural configuration.
- Aloe Vera ❉ Used in various African and diasporic communities for its soothing and hydrating properties, supporting scalp health and aiding in detangling textured coils.
- Chebe Powder ❉ Originating from Chadian Basara women, this blend of herbs is traditionally used to strengthen hair, reduce breakage, and promote length retention, directly addressing the fragility of textured hair at its bending points.

How Does Uneven Keratinization Shape Textured Hair?
Beyond the visible follicle and shaft, the very composition of the hair strand itself, particularly the process of keratinization, offers further insight into textured hair’s distinct form. Keratin, the primary protein of hair, is not uniform throughout the strand. Research has shown that in textured hair, the distribution of keratin types (specifically, the α-keratin and β-keratin isoforms) and the cross-linking of disulfide bonds can vary along the hair’s circumference. This unevenness in keratinization, occurring as the hair cells mature and harden, further contributes to the hair’s inherent coiling.
One side of the hair strand might contract or develop differently than the other, creating a natural bias towards curvature. This molecular dance, often unseen, is a profound aspect of textured hair’s uniqueness, influencing its elasticity, strength, and propensity for tangling. The challenges some textured hair types face, such as dryness or fragility at the curl’s apex, find their root in these micro-structural variations, a truth acknowledged in historical care practices that focused on fortifying the strand.

The Significance of Moisture Balance?
The discussion of textured hair’s core structural differences often leads to a crucial point of concern ❉ moisture retention. Due to the lifted cuticle scales at the numerous curves and bends, textured hair has a larger surface area exposed compared to straight hair. This increased exposure, coupled with the difficulty of natural sebum (scalp oil) to travel down the coiling shaft, renders textured hair more susceptible to dehydration. From a biological standpoint, the hair’s structure itself presents a challenge to moisture equilibrium.
Historically, this understanding was not articulated in scientific terms, but the ancestral practices of sealing moisture with rich oils and butters—like shea butter, cocoa butter, or various plant-based oils from indigenous flora—were direct, effective responses. These rituals were designed to mimic the protective barrier that sebum might naturally provide, acting as occlusive agents to slow down water loss from the hair shaft. Consider the historical development of haircare within the African diaspora. Following the transatlantic slave trade, access to traditional ingredients and rituals was often disrupted, yet the ingenuity and adaptive spirit of Black communities persevered. The creation of various hair pomades and greases, often homemade initially, served to replicate the function of natural emollients and provide protection, particularly for hair prone to dryness due to its unique structure.
These formulations, while sometimes containing less beneficial ingredients in later commercialized forms, were fundamentally rooted in addressing the structural implications of textured hair – its need for lubrication and moisture sealing. The Hair’s Thermal Sensitivity
The structural integrity of textured hair, particularly at the points of its curves and coils, also influences its sensitivity to heat. The numerous bends create potential stress points where heat can more easily compromise the protein structure. Over time, excessive heat exposure can lead to irreversible damage to the hair’s natural curl pattern, a phenomenon known as “heat damage.” This scientific understanding validates the historical wisdom often found in communities that cautioned against frequent application of high heat, or relied on low-heat or no-heat styling methods. The careful use of warm water, steam, or air-drying techniques, often seen in ancestral hair care, reflects an intuitive grasp of the hair’s thermal vulnerabilities.
